As of June 04, 2026, Lee Manor Apartments in Athens, Tennessee is offering 90 units approved for Low Income Housing. This affordable housing development provides options for individuals who meet specific income and eligibility criteria, with rental prices ranging from $215 to $379.
*Rent estimates are calculated using Mcminn County Fair Market Rents for 2026 and assume the 30% extremely low income threshold is met. This means that the tenant will be responsible for 30% of the Fair Market Rent for this unit. It is recommended to contact the Athens Housing Authority for exact rent pricing.
